B. Riley Securities Acts as Joint Lead Bookrunner in Bit Digital’s $150MM Convertible Notes Offering

B. Riley Securities, a middle market investment bank, served as joint lead book-running manager for Bit Digital’s public offering of $150 million aggregate principal amount of 4.00% convertible senior notes due 2030. The transaction included the underwriters’ full exercise of the overallotment option for an additional $15 million of notes, issued on the same terms and conditions.

Bit Digital intends to use the net proceeds primarily to purchase Ethereum and for general corporate purposes, including potential investments, acquisitions and other digital asset-related opportunities.

This marks the fourth transaction that B. Riley Securities has led or jointly led on behalf of Bit Digital, spanning M&A advisory, equity raises and now this timely convertible notes offering.

B. Riley Securities’ investment banking team was led by Joe Nardini and Patrick Hanniford, and included Alex Wolodzko and Hayden Kickbush. Its capital markets team was led by Pat Pilouk, Jimmy Baker and Ryan Aceto, with Dawn Farrell and Forbes Aggabao.
